1. Ursuline Academy (Wilmington)Head coach: John Noonan
2015-16 record: 19-5, state champion
Most every class is represented in the Raiders' probable starting lineup as they aim to three-peat as state champions. Senior
Kryshell Gorder, junior
Maggie Connolly and sophomore
Alisha Lewis are the returning starters and most likely will be joined by sophomore
Yanni Hendley-mccalla and junior
Olivia Mason. Senior
Lindsay Brown, junior
Allison Olmstead and sophomore
Kay Wulah are expected to play significant minutes.

2015-16 record: 17-5
Sanford's returning starters from last year's team that reached the state title game are all sophomores.
Lauren Park-Lane,
Olivia Tucker and
Samantha Pollich will be joined by first-time regular starters junior
Lexi Fotakos and sophomore
Kendra Warren as the Warriors shoot for a return trip to the finals.

2015-16 record: 15-7
Caravel returns all five starters and a top newcomer that give the Bucs the potential to be a state title contender. Seniors
Grace Lange, juniors
Maia Bryson and
Kaylee Otlowski, and sophomores
Karli Cauley and
Ondia Brown all return and welcome sophomore
Sasha Marvel, who is expected to play major minutes.

2015-16 record: 21-2
Concord was undefeated before losing its final regular season game and then the state tournament semifinal game to eventual state champion Ursuline Academy. Junior guard
Aahliyah Selby, a first-team All-State selection, leads an experienced lineup that includes returning senior starters
Jamiyah Dennis and
Caroline Procak, and junior
Zhan'e Snow.

2015-16 record: 17-4
Senior forward
Alanna Speaks, senior point guard
Alexis Bromwell and junior center
Alexis Lee return as starters to give the Vikings a talented veteran lineup that will be even stronger with the addition of freshman guard
Sha'nia Davis.
